Understanding the Basics of UV DTF Printing Techniques
UV DTF printing techniques have emerged as a formidable alternative to traditional methods, offering a level of precision and vibrancy that appeals to both professionals and hobbyists alike. By using transfer films as an intermediary, this printing method allows for the application of intricate designs onto various materials such as textiles, wood, glass, and metal. The process is relatively straightforward—design your graphic, print it onto the film using a UV printer, and then transfer it to your desired substrate without the need for cumbersome heat presses, marking a significant innovation in the field of custom printing.
The technology relies on ultraviolet light to rapidly cure inks as they are applied, ensuring that colors not only pop but also adhere securely to the transfer film. This means that UV DTF transfer printing can produce designs that maintain their vibrancy even after extensive washing and exposure to elements, which is a notable advantage for anyone entering the custom printing market. The Step-by-Step Process of UV DTF Transfer Printing
The UV DTF printing process begins with meticulous design preparation. High-resolution graphics are essential to ensure that every detail translates well onto the transfer film. Utilizing advanced design software allows printers to make adjustments in colors and layouts that will yield the best results. Whether creating intricate logos or vibrant patterns, this stage sets the tone for the final product’s quality—something that cannot be overlooked in the successful implementation of printing techniques.
Once the design is ready, it’s printed onto the specially coated transfer film. The application of UV inks during this phase is not merely about the visual output but also about ensuring the print adheres correctly upon transfer. The creation process incorporates intensive print settings to ensure the inks are cured efficiently with ultraviolet light, solidifying their connection to the film while retaining color fidelity. Finally, the application process—peeling the film and transferring the design onto the target surface—requires careful handling to secure a smooth finish. Each of these steps is critical for achieving successful results in UV DTF transfer printing.
Essential Tips for Successful UV DTF Printing
Success in UV DTF printing hinges on several key practices that printers should adopt. Firstly, utilizing high-quality materials such as premium transfer films and UV inks is essential. The durability and vibrancy of prints largely depend on the compatibility of these materials with each other, making it paramount to invest in quality. Additionally, printers should control ink density—achieving the right balance allows for enhanced color saturation without risking bleeding or washout effects.
Furthermore, optimizing curing times is crucial in ensuring that prints retain their vibrancy while ensuring durability. Too quick a cure may lead to incomplete adhesion, while a cure that is too long may over-saturate the transfer film. Experimenting with these variables during preliminary test runs can yield insights that help refine the process before moving into full production, satisfying both aesthetic and pragmatic needs of custom printing.
